#769e95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#769e95 is composed of 46.3% red, 62%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 166.5 degrees, a saturation of 17.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#769e95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#003d2b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#769e95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#769e95 has RGB values of R:118, G:158,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 7773845.

Shades and Tints of #769e95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f7f7 is the lightest one.
